Judaism, Islam, and Christianity are similar because they are all three monotheistic religions— which means they all worship one supreme God as opposed to multiple— that originated in the Middle East. They also share similar core values like love of God and love of others.
They are different in a few ways: Christianity believes in a trinity (three distinct parts of one God) while Islam and Judaism both have a non-Trinitarian belief system. Judaism and Islam is based more about salvation by good works, while Christianity is about trusting Jesus as salvation. They also have different holy books, the Holy Bible, (Christianity) the Hebrew Tanakh, (Judaism) and the Quran (Islam.)

<h3 /><h3>What is performance risk?</h3>
Corresponds to the risk related to a purchase, that is, a consumer who pays for a product expecting to obtain a benefit, but that this benefit is not fulfilled due to a defect in the manufacture or in some expected specification.
Therefore, performance risk legally guarantees that the buyer will not be harmed by any non-conformity in the purchased product.
